Floating SnackBar in Flutter

We know how to show the snack bar in a flutter, but everybody wants the application must look more interactive and user-friendly, that’s why we can use animations or new designs in the application, And also Floating snack bar is one of them. A snack bar is a pop-up that animates from the bottom of the application to show the user interaction or user activity. How to Use:
FloatingSnackBar(
message: 'Hi GeeksforGeeks, we are back',
context: context,
textColor: Colors.black,
textStyle: const TextStyle(color: Colors.green),
duration: const Duration(milliseconds: 4000),
backgroundColor: Color.fromARGB(255, 220, 234, 236),
);
Step By Step Implementation
Step 1: Create a New Project in Android Studio
To set up Flutter Development on Android Studio please refer to Android Studio Setup for Flutter Development, and then create a new project in Android Studio please refer to Creating a Simple Application in Flutter.
Step 2: Import the Package in the pubspec.yaml File.
Now we need to import the package into the pubspec.yaml file, which you find at the last of the root folder.
From the command line:
flutter pub add floating_snackbar

Step 3: Import the package into the main file
Adding material package that gives us the important functions and calls the run app method in the main function that will call our application.
import 'package:flutter/material.dart';
import 'package:floating_snackbar/floating_snackbar.dart';
void main() {
runApp(RunMyApp());
}

Step 6: Using Floating SnackBar
Now the main part of the example, use the center widget to show the button in the center of the body of the application, then in on pressed property we can use the Floating SnackBar and assign its parameters.
Complete Code:
Dart
import 'package:floating_snackbar/floating_snackbar.dart' ;
import 'package:flutter/material.dart' ;
void main() {
runApp(MaterialApp(
debugShowCheckedModeBanner: false ,
theme: ThemeData(primarySwatch: Colors.green),
home:RunMyApp()));
}
class RunMyApp extends StatefulWidget {
const RunMyApp({super.key});
@override
State<RunMyApp> createState() => _RunMyAppState();
}
class _RunMyAppState extends State<RunMyApp> {
@override
Widget build(BuildContext context) {
return Scaffold(
appBar: AppBar(
title: Text( 'Floating Snackbar' ),
),
body: Center(
child: TextButton(
onPressed: () {
FloatingSnackBar(
message: 'Hi GeeksforGeeks, we are back' ,
context: context,
textColor: Colors.black,
textStyle: const TextStyle(color: Colors.green),
duration: const Duration(milliseconds: 4000),
backgroundColor: Color.fromARGB(255, 220, 234, 236),
);
},
child: const Text( 'Show Floating SnackBar' ),
),
),
);
}
}
